Game Mode: Your System's Dedicated Gamer
Windows 11 has a built-in feature called Game Mode designed to prioritize game performance. It reduces background activity from things like Windows Updates and notifications, freeing up system resources for your games.
How to Enable: Simply go to Settings > Gaming > Game Mode and toggle it on . It's a simple switch, but the impact can be significant, especially on less powerful systems. Game Mode essentially tells Windows, "Hey, I'm playing a game, so focus all your energy here!" Think of it as putting your PC in a "do not disturb" mode specifically for gaming. This prevents pesky notifications from popping up at the worst possible moment (like during a clutch play!) and ensures your CPU and GPU are dedicating their resources to the game.
It's generally a good idea to leave Game Mode enabled all the time, but if you experience any unexpected issues with a specific game, try disabling it temporarily to see if that resolves the problem.
Graphics Settings: Prioritize Performance
Tweaking your graphics settings is crucial for maximizing frame rates and minimizing lag. This involves adjusting settings both within Windows and within the games themselves.
Windows Graphics Settings: Navigate to Settings > Display > Graphics. Here, you can specify which graphics card (if you have multiple) should be used for specific applications. Make sure your high-performance GPU is selected for your games. You can also enable Hardware-accelerated GPU scheduling , which can improve performance by allowing the GPU to manage its own memory.
Game-Specific Settings: Dive into the settings menu of each game and experiment with different graphics options. Lowering settings like shadow quality, anti-aliasing, and texture resolution can significantly boost frame rates without drastically impacting visual quality. Don't be afraid to experiment! Each game is different, and finding the right balance between performance and visuals is key. A good starting point is to set everything to "Medium" and then gradually increase settings until you find a sweet spot where you're getting acceptable frame rates without sacrificing too much visual fidelity.
Pro Tip : Keep an eye on your GPU and CPU usage while gaming. If either one is consistently hitting 100%, you'll likely need to lower your graphics settings to improve performance. Tools like MSI Afterburner or the Windows Task Manager can help you monitor these metrics.
Update Your Drivers: Keep Your Hardware Happy
Outdated drivers can cause a range of issues, from poor performance to crashes. Keeping your drivers up to date is essential for a smooth gaming experience.
Nvidia/AMD Drivers: Regularly check the Nvidia GeForce Experience or AMD Adrenalin software for driver updates. These applications will automatically notify you when new drivers are available and make the installation process simple. Other Drivers: Don't forget to update other drivers as well, such as your motherboard chipset drivers, audio drivers, and network drivers. You can usually find these on the manufacturer's website. Using outdated drivers is like trying to run a modern engine on old, worn-out tires. It's just not going to work well! New drivers often include performance optimizations and bug fixes specifically for the latest games, so staying up-to-date is crucial for getting the best possible performance.
A Word of Caution : While it's generally recommended to update to the latest drivers, sometimes new drivers can introduce new problems. If you experience issues after updating, you can usually roll back to a previous driver version.
Disable Startup Programs: Streamline Your System
Many applications launch automatically when you start your computer, consuming system resources and slowing down your gaming performance. Disabling unnecessary startup programs can free up valuable resources.
Task Manager: Open Task Manager (Ctrl+Shift+Esc) and go to the "Startup" tab. Here, you'll see a list of programs that launch at startup. Disable any programs that you don't need running in the background, such as cloud storage services, messaging apps, or software updaters.
Think of your system's resources as a limited supply of energy. The more programs that are running in the background, the less energy there is available for your games. Disabling unnecessary startup programs is like cutting off the power supply to unused appliances in your house, freeing up more energy for the things that really matter. Be careful when disabling startup programs, as some are essential for your system to function properly. If you're unsure about a particular program, do a quick Google search to find out what it does.
Tweak Power Settings: Unleash Maximum Performance
Windows 11 offers different power plans that prioritize either energy efficiency or performance. For gaming, you'll want to use the High Performance or Ultimate Performance power plan.
Power Options: Go to Settings > System > Power & Battery. Under "Power mode," select "Best performance." If you don't see the "Ultimate Performance" option, you can enable it through the command prompt. Open Command Prompt as administrator and run the following command: `powercfg /duplicatescheme e9a42b02-d5df-448d-aa00-03f14749eb61`.
Choosing the right power plan is like choosing the right fuel for your car. If you're driving a race car, you wouldn't use low-grade fuel, would you? Similarly, you need to use a power plan that's optimized for performance when you're gaming. The "High Performance" and "Ultimate Performance" power plans allow your CPU and GPU to run at their maximum clock speeds, delivering the best possible gaming performance. Be aware that these power plans will consume more energy, so your laptop battery may drain faster.

Overclocking: Pushing Your Hardware to the Limit
Overclocking involves increasing the clock speeds of your CPU and GPU beyond their default settings. This can result in significant performance improvements, but it also comes with risks.
CPU Overclocking: Requires accessing your motherboard's BIOS and adjusting various settings. It's crucial to have a good understanding of your hardware and the potential risks involved before attempting to overclock your CPU. Improper overclocking can damage your components. GPU Overclocking: Can be done using software like MSI Afterburner or EVGA Precision X1. These tools allow you to adjust the clock speeds, voltage, and fan speeds of your GPU. Again, proceed with caution and monitor your temperatures closely to avoid overheating.
Overclocking is like giving your engine a shot of adrenaline. It can boost performance significantly, but it also puts more stress on your components. Before overclocking, make sure you have adequate cooling and that you understand the risks involved. There are plenty of online guides and communities that can provide helpful information and advice. Always start with small increments and test your system thoroughly after each change to ensure stability.
Defragment Your Hard Drive (HDD Only): Organize Your Data
If you're still using a traditional hard drive (HDD) instead of a solid-state drive (SSD), defragmenting your drive can improve performance by reorganizing the data on the drive.
Defragmentation Tool: Windows 11 has a built-in defragmentation tool. Search for "defragment and optimize drives" in the Start menu and run the tool.
Think of your hard drive as a library. Over time, files become fragmented, meaning that parts of the file are stored in different locations on the drive. When you try to access a fragmented file, the hard drive has to work harder to find all the pieces, which slows down performance. Defragmentation reorganizes the files so that they are stored in contiguous blocks, making them easier to access. However, defragmenting an SSD is not recommended , as it can actually reduce its lifespan.
Optimize Your SSD: Maintain Peak Performance
While SSDs don't need to be defragmented, there are other ways to optimize them for gaming.
TRIM Command: Ensure that the TRIM command is enabled. This allows the SSD to efficiently manage its storage space and maintain optimal performance. Windows 11 automatically enables TRIM for SSDs. Over-provisioning: Some SSDs allow you to allocate a portion of the drive's storage space as "over-provisioning." This provides the SSD controller with more space to work with, which can improve performance and longevity. Check your SSD manufacturer's website for instructions on how to enable over-provisioning.
SSDs are much faster than traditional hard drives, but they still require some maintenance to ensure they perform optimally. The TRIM command helps the SSD to reclaim unused storage space, while over-provisioning provides the controller with extra space to manage data. These optimizations can help to keep your SSD running at its best.
Disable Visual Effects: Focus on Performance
Windows 11 has a variety of visual effects that can add to the user experience, but they can also consume system resources. Disabling unnecessary visual effects can free up resources for gaming.
Performance Options: Search for "adjust the appearance and performance of Windows" in the Start menu. In the "Visual Effects" tab, select "Adjust for best performance." This will disable most of the visual effects. You can then selectively re-enable the effects that you want to keep.
Visual effects like animations and shadows can make Windows look more polished, but they also require processing power. Disabling these effects can free up resources that can be used for gaming. If you're running on a lower-end system, this can make a noticeable difference.
Adjust Virtual Memory: Prevent Out-of-Memory Errors
Virtual memory is a portion of your hard drive that is used as an extension of your RAM. If you're running low on RAM, increasing the size of your virtual memory can prevent out-of-memory errors and improve performance.
Virtual Memory Settings: Search for "adjust the appearance and performance of Windows" in the Start menu. Go to the "Advanced" tab and click "Change" under "Virtual memory." Uncheck "Automatically manage paging file size for all drives" and then select "Custom size." Enter an initial size and a maximum size for your virtual memory. A good rule of thumb is to set the initial size to 1.5 times your RAM and the maximum size to 3 times your RAM.
Virtual memory can help to prevent crashes and improve performance when you're running demanding games. However, it's important to note that accessing data from your hard drive is much slower than accessing data from RAM, so increasing your RAM is always the best solution if you're consistently running out of memory.
Monitor Your System: Keep an Eye on Performance
After making these optimizations, it's important to monitor your system to see how they're affecting performance.
Task Manager: A Quick Overview
Task Manager provides a quick overview of your CPU, memory, disk, and network usage. You can use it to identify processes that are consuming excessive resources.
Open Task Manager: Press Ctrl+Shift+Esc. Monitor Performance: Go to the "Performance" tab to see real-time graphs of your system's resource usage.
Resource Monitor: A Deeper Dive
Resource Monitor provides more detailed information about your system's resource usage than Task Manager.
Open Resource Monitor: Search for "resource monitor" in the Start menu. Analyze Performance: Use Resource Monitor to identify specific processes that are causing performance bottlenecks.
In-Game Performance Metrics: Track Frame Rates and More
Many games have built-in performance metrics that allow you to track frame rates, CPU usage, GPU usage, and other important information.
Enable Performance Overlay: Check your game's settings menu for an option to enable a performance overlay.
Monitoring your system's performance is crucial for identifying bottlenecks and ensuring that your optimizations are having the desired effect. Use Task Manager, Resource Monitor, and in-game performance metrics to track your system's resource usage and identify any areas that need further attention.
